there has been a few boys on Crx Aus who have done the swap and still love it after all the time and money they spent
A DC2R B18cr makes good power to weight but you will have upgrade the other parts alot eg. brakes, suspension and front traction bar kit to clear some of the exhaust header that are available for big power
